Transaction 85825835d62b5ab1665d82b78efc48de4fa07b329a5e49d38f3f7bdca456a20f
1 Input
1 Output
-
85825835d62b5ab1665d82b78efc48de4fa07b329a5e49d38f3f7bdca456a20f:0
- value
- 3283799
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42b86372cefd8e61903f62d9c7feffbe512d0ebc OP_EQUAL
- address
- 37moQjswvgPiVr3bhPDPU3LbpKfDd3HEG7